roach robots to the rescue\nwhen buildings collapse, it is extremely difficult to safely locate and rescue people trapped inside. victims may be wedged into small spaces, and unstable rubble could collapse on rescue workers. an alternative to human rescue workers may be robotic cockroaches. real cockroaches are protected by strong yet flexible exoskeletons. they can also flatten their bodies through tiny cracks. a robotics researcher from harvard university and a biomechanics expert from the university of california, berkeley, were inspired to create mini robots that have the same features. the roach robots can squeeze through small spaces and skitter over unstable environments. fitted with cameras and microphones, they could be used in disasters to locate victims.\nwhat is the main, or central, idea of the passage?\ncockroach - like robots can fit through small cracks and move through unstable rubble.\ninspired by the strength and quickness of cockroaches, researchers created robots with the same characteristics.\nit is dangerous to search inside collapsed buildings, but cockroach - like robots can go places where human searchers cant or shouldnt.
